The Pepto guitar is considered one of the best sounding blackknife guitars according to Geoff Gould. Like someone mentioned Weir started playing the guitar in 1988. The pickups had the single coils squeezed together like his Cocobolo guitar but a couple months ago the pickguard broke and they switched the guard back to a standard strat style pickguard. Weir also wanted to get rid of the graphite neck and the neck was changed to a custom bolt on neck like the Genesis style necks. They still have a graphite rod through the neck just like the genesis.
